When Is Emergency AC Replacement Necessary?
Emergency AC replacement is necessary if you notice compressor failure, repeated breakdowns, aging equipment, electrical damage, or excessive repair costs.
Below is how each issue affects your system and why replacement may be the safer long-term solution.
Complete Compressor Failure
The compressor is the core of your air conditioning system. When it fails, cooling stops entirely, and repair costs can be high, especially in older units. We inspect the compressor condition, evaluate overall system wear, and determine whether replacing the full system will provide greater reliability and long-term savings.
Repeated Breakdowns During Heatwaves
If your AC fails multiple times in one season, it is often a sign of internal component fatigue. Constant emergency calls can add up quickly and create stress during peak summer heat. We review your repair history, assess system stability, and explain whether ongoing fixes are practical or if a full replacement will eliminate recurring disruptions.
15+ Year Old Equipment Losing Efficiency
Older systems naturally lose efficiency and struggle to maintain steady cooling under heavy demand. Parts become harder to source, and energy consumption increases over time. We evaluate your system’s age, condition, and operating performance to determine if upgrading to a modern high-efficiency unit will improve comfort and reduce operating costs.
Electrical or Structural Damage
Burned wiring, damaged coils, or major refrigerant leaks can compromise system safety and performance. These issues may indicate deeper internal deterioration rather than a single failed component. We conduct a full system inspection to confirm whether safe repair is possible or if replacement is the more secure option.
Repair Costs Exceed Long-Term Value
When repair costs approach a significant share of the system’s remaining value, continuing to invest in temporary fixes may no longer make financial sense. Frequent large repairs often signal broader system decline. We provide a clear cost comparison so you can decide confidently whether replacement offers better long-term stability.
What To Expect During an Emergency AC Replacement
When cooling fails completely, every decision impacts performance, efficiency, and long-term reliability. Our process is structured to restore comfort quickly while ensuring the new system is properly designed for your home.
When we confirm that replacement is the right move, we follow a clear and proven installation process.
1. Rapid System Evaluation
We begin with a full inspection of your existing condenser, evaporator coil, refrigerant lines, and electrical components to verify that replacement is truly necessary. This prevents premature upgrades and ensures we are not overlooking a safe repair option. You receive a clear explanation of why replacement is recommended before moving forward.
2. Precision Load Calculation
Proper sizing is critical during emergency replacement. We calculate the correct British Thermal Units (BTUs) required for your home based on square footage, insulation levels, window exposure, and airflow layout. Oversized and undersized systems both cause efficiency problems, so we ensure the new unit is matched accurately to your cooling demand.
3. Equipment Selection & Transparent Options
We present system options based on efficiency level, budget range, and long-term energy performance. This may include central air systems or heat pump configurations, depending on your home setup. We explain operating costs, expected lifespan, and warranty coverage so you can make a confident decision.
4. Professional Removal & Installation
Our team safely removes the old condenser and indoor coil, inspects or replaces the line set if needed, and verifies proper electrical disconnect configuration. Because our trucks operate as a warehouse on wheels, we carry essential installation materials and components to prevent unnecessary delays. All work is completed in accordance with manufacturer specifications and local standards.
5. System Startup & Performance Verification
After installation, we charge the system correctly, test airflow balance, verify thermostat communication, and confirm stable temperature drop. We perform a full operational cycle to ensure the outdoor and indoor units operate efficiently together. Before leaving, we walk you through the system operation and answer any questions.

Types of Air Conditioning Systems We Replace in Ogden Homes
When emergency replacement is necessary, selecting the right system type is critical. Below are the primary cooling systems we replace for homeowners across Ogden and Weber County.
Central Air Conditioning Systems
Central AC systems are the most common whole-home cooling setup. They use an outdoor condenser, an indoor coil, and existing ductwork to distribute air evenly throughout the house. During replacement, we ensure proper airflow balance, updated electrical connections, and clean integration with your current duct system, so performance is stable from day one.
Air-Source Heat Pumps
Air-source heat pumps provide both cooling and heating in one system. These units are energy-efficient and ideal for homeowners upgrading older single-stage air conditioners. When replacing a traditional system with a heat pump, we verify thermostat compatibility, electrical capacity, and duct performance to ensure seamless operation.
Ductless Mini-Split Systems
Ductless mini-split systems are designed for homes without ductwork or for zoned cooling in specific rooms. These systems allow independent temperature control in different areas of the home. During replacement, we assess mounting locations, drainage routing, and zone sizing to ensure reliable comfort and quiet performance.
Every replacement is based on your home’s layout, existing infrastructure, and long-term reliability goals. Our focus is not just on installing new equipment, but ensuring the system type truly fits your home.
